#4943b4 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#4943b4 is composed of 28.6% red, 26.3% green and 70.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 59.4% cyan, 62.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 29.4% black. It has a hue angle of 243.2 degrees, a saturation of 45.7% and a lightness of 48.4%. #4943b4 color hex could be obtained by blending #9286ff with #000069. Closest websafe color is: #3333cc.

Shades and Tints of #4943b4

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030308 is the darkest color, while #f9f9f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#4943b4

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#737385 is the less saturated color, while #0e00f7 is the most saturated one.
